If your Subaru Sedan is overheating or leaking coolant, you've come to the right place. The summer and winter months are hardest on your Sedan radiator, but quality cooling is needed all year long to prevent damage and increase performance. Letting a car continue to run hot, or even just cool inefficiently, can contribute to bad gas mileage, the risk of rupturing a head gasket, and even allow the entire engine to catch on fire if not properly taken care of. Replacing a Subaru radiator is usually much cheaper than you'd think, and your Subaru Sedan should probably get a new radiator at least every four to six years, less if it shows signs of wear or leakage.
